Piazza Della Vittoria in Genoa is a captivating blend of history and modern leisure. Dominating the square is the majestic Arco della Vittoria, a triumphal arch that stands as a memorial to Italy's heroes of the First World War. Designed by Marcello Piacentini with sculptures by Arturo Dazzi, the arch and its accompanying statues, like the one by Eugenio Baroni, add a touch of grandeur to the atmosphere. Families will appreciate the square's child-friendly environment, where a day can be pleasantly spent relaxing or enjoying a picnic in the scenic surroundings. The nearby cafes offer a delightful break, and convenient underground parking ensures an easy visit. For those looking to explore more, Piazza Della Vittoria is just a short stroll from Piazza De Ferrari, linked by the bustling Via XX Settembre. From the skyview observatory, a stunning panoramic vista of Genoa awaits, allowing visitors to appreciate the city's beauty from above.
